Learn Cyber Security and Ethical Hacking with practical hands-on training and real-world attack simulations. This course is designed for students, IT professionals, and beginners who want to understand how cyber attacks happen and how systems can be protected from security threats. In this course, you will start with the fundamentals of cyber security, understanding how networks work, common vulnerabilities, and how hackers exploit weak systems. You will then move into practical ethical hacking techniques using industry tools such as Kali Linux, Nmap, Wireshark, and other penetration testing tools. You will learn how to perform network scanning, vulnerability assessment, password cracking, and web application security testing. The course also covers important concepts like SQL Injection, Cross-Site Scripting (XSS), authentication attacks, and security misconfigurations. Throughout the course, you will work on realistic attack simulations and practical labs, helping you understand how professional ethical hackers test systems and identify vulnerabilities. You will also learn how to secure systems, prevent attacks, and implement security best practices. By the end of this course, you will have a strong understanding of cyber security principles, ethical hacking techniques, and modern security tools, enabling you to begin your journey toward becoming a cyber security analyst or ethical hacker. This course is ideal for anyone interested in cyber security, penetration testing, network security, or ethical hacking careers.
